Facts about The Wall Song

✔️

Who wrote The Wall Song lyrics?


The Wall Song is written by David Van Cortlandt Crosby.
✔️

When was The Wall Song released?


It is first released in 1972 as part of Crosby & Nash's album "Graham Nash David Crosby"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is The Wall Song?


The Wall Song falls under the genre Rock.
✔️

How long is the song The Wall Song?


The Wall Song song length is 4 minutes and 25 seconds.
